Abstract
Aluminium alkoxide sulphate catalysts have been used to promote ethoxylatio n of fatty alcohols with a narrow distribution of the molecular weights. Ba sed on experimental observations, a reaction mechanism and a related kineti c model able to simulate all the performed kinetic runs have been proposed in a previous work by M. Di Serio et al. [M. Di Serio, P. Iengo, R. Gobetto , S. Bruni, E. Santacesaria, J. Mol. Catal. A: Chem. 112(1996)235]. In the present work the plausibility of the mechanism suggested and the role playe d by the sulphate groups in the reaction have been evaluate by a computatio nal study. The promoting effect on the reaction rate of sulphate groups is similar to that observed in the heterogeneous catalysis for different oxide s treated with sulphuric acid, so the results obtained in this work will al so be applied to explain the catalytic behaviour of sulphated alumina.
